Swiss Lathe Machining: The key Behind Intricate Areas
Swiss lathe machining (also referred to as Swiss-form turning) is actually a specialised procedure perfect for producing modest, complex, and substantial-precision pieces. Frequent in watchmaking and professional medical unit production, Swiss equipment use a sliding headstock that supports the fabric nearer to the reducing Software, decreasing deflection and rising precision.
Benefits:
Incredibly restricted tolerances
Perfect for small diameter components
Great for elaborate part machining
Lowered cycle periods
Swiss lathes are important for producing components in which precision is non-negotiable, for example surgical devices or aerospace fasteners.

Vacuum Casting & Polyurethane Vacuum Casting
Vacuum casting is a flexible approach employed for making substantial-fidelity prototypes and compact manufacturing operates applying silicone molds. It is Specially practical in plastic item production.
Polyurethane vacuum casting, specifically, features a wide range of content Houses—rigid, adaptable, distinct, or colored—which makes it perfect for:
Purchaser product enclosures
Automotive elements
Practical screening styles
Simulated injection-molded pieces
This method provides an economical substitute to entire injection mildew tooling, specially for small-quantity output.

CNC Milling and Turning: The Spine of Modern Machining
Latest equipment retailers present each CNC milling and turning expert services to cover an array of pieces. Milling is ideal for producing flat surfaces, slots, and holes, though turning excels at cylindrical components.
When blended into multi-axis CNC machining units, these capabilities enable for finish pieces to become manufactured in only one setup—enhancing effectiveness and cutting down human mistake.
Typical components incorporate:
Gears
Housings
Connectors
Flanges
Brackets

Injection Mould Tooling and Manufacturing: From Principle to Sector
Injection mold tooling is the entire process of developing hardened steel molds for mass manufacturing. It truly is an important expense, but when you are All set for scale, it’s the most Price-powerful system for plastic products manufacturing.
As soon as tooling is full, injection mildew generation can churn out hundreds or many consistent parts at a reduced per-unit Expense.
Modern day mildew design and style typically involves:
Conformal cooling channels
Slide and lifter mechanisms
Multi-cavity and relatives mildew programs
Automated portion ejection
